This Graduate Certificate in Korean Fight Scene Planning provides specialized training in the art of designing and choreographing dynamic and authentic Korean fight sequences for film, television, and other visual media. Students will gain a deep understanding of traditional Korean martial arts and their application in modern action filmmaking.
The program's learning outcomes include mastering the principles of fight choreography, storyboarding techniques specific to Korean action styles, safe stunt planning and execution, and collaboration with directors and actors. Students will also develop strong communication and leadership skills crucial for on-set success. The curriculum incorporates practical, hands-on experience with professional-grade equipment.
Duration of the program is typically one year, completed through a combination of intensive workshops, online modules and independent project work. The flexible structure allows students to balance their studies with existing professional commitments, making it ideal for working professionals seeking to enhance their skills.
